IOO charges 0.4% p.a. and SPY charges 0.09% p.a.; the lower fee leads on cost.
IOO manages $5.7B and SPY manages $1089.4B; the larger fund leads on scale, which can support tighter spreads.
IOO holds 117 positions and SPY holds 504; the fund with broader holdings leads on diversification.
IOO distributes approximately 1.08% (Semi-annually) and SPY approximately 1% (Quarterly); the higher distribution yield leads on income.

IOO and SPY have approximately 85% estimated holdings overlap, based on the top 10 listed holdings of each fund. This is considered high overlap, estimated from listed top holdings rather than the full constituent lists. General information only, not financial advice.
SPY has the lower management fee. IOO charges 0.4% per year ($40 per year on a $10,000 investment) and SPY charges 0.09% per year ($9 per year on a $10,000 investment). The difference is $31 per year per $10,000 invested. General information only, not financial advice.
IOO (iShares Global 100 ETF) manages approximately $5.7B and SPY (State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ust) manages approximately $1089.4B. Fund size can affect liquidity and bid-ask spreads but does not by itself change the management fee. General information only, not financial advice.
You can hold both, but with approximately 85% estimated holdings overlap the two funds hold a high proportion of the same companies, so holding both means paying two sets of management fees on largely the same exposure.
